Job Responsibilities:
∎ Coordinate to implement the overall operational plan for gender mainstreaming and disability inclusion in the FDMN and Host communities in HCMP
∎ Provide technical guidance to other sectors/clusters (Education, Health, DRR, Shelter, Protection) in HCMP to ensure gender mainstreaming and disability inclusion
∎ Support capacity building for staff, partners, volunteers, community groups, in HCMP on implementing activities for gender mainstreaming and disability inclusion
∎ Provide technical support to the sectors/clusters in HCMP in facilitating training on gender mainstreaming and on the use of gender-analysis tools, gender-sensitive monitoring and reporting
∎ Take initiative for gender skill transfer of selected staff, volunteers, partners in HCMP
∎ Organize, facilitate and participate in local level meeting, dialogue, training, workshop, event on gender and disability issues etc
∎ Ensure effective local level advocacy and mmaintain key professional networks, relationships with other partners, national and international agencies, civil society organisations working on gender and disability issues at the local level.
∎ Organize and celebrate days and events for promoting gender equality and disability inclusion in FDMN and Host communities in Coxs Bazar
∎ Identify operational challenges and take steps for problem solving for ensuring gender mainstreaming and disability inclusion
∎ Ensure effective field-based budget expenditure in collaboration with local accounts in Cox’s Bazar
∎ Ensure regular documentation and reporting to respective supervisor
∎ Prepare monthly and annual plan action plan, meeting plan, periodic progress report, set targets and deliver to respective supervisor
∎ Ensure the safety of team members from any harm, abuse, neglect, harassment and exploitation to achieve the programme’s goals on safeguarding implementation. Act as a key source of support, guidance and expertise on safeguarding for establishing a safe working environment.
∎ Practice, promote and endorse the issues of safeguarding policy among team members and ensure the implementation of safeguarding standards in every course of action
∎ Follow the safeguarding reporting procedure in case any reportable incident takes place, encourage others to do so.
